I almost bought DerDieDas but DH said it's too big for the little boy as he's quite small frame. In the end, we bought the cheaper range, Deuter scholar. However, DS is complaining that the bag is very heavy. I realise most of the ergonomic bags when empty, are at least about 1kg. I saw some kids carrying the lighter version of Deuter but i can't find those lighter ones in the stores. -

Some of the Deuter models are ergonomic. I bought one for my dd1 but turns out most of the books are kept in school. So for ds, I might just buy a ordinary sturdy one instead of ergonomic.
I'm not sure if this is the arrangement for all P1s, so best to chk.
